Welcome to season seven for the “Hotlanta” ladies of Bravo! The reunion from last season left a lot of strings untied and relationships rocked. First thing’s first, who’s back as an official housewife and who has been moved to the B-list “friend of the housewives” category? Queen of Atlanta Nene Leakes, lawyer turned funeral home boss Phaedra Parks, model mogul Cynthia Bailey, newly wedded crooner Kandi Burruss and gone with the wind fabulous Kenya Moore are all holding those coveted peaches as official housewives. Thug life Porsha Williams has dropped her role to a recurring “friend” but its evident that her presence will still be felt throughout the season in a big way.
Nene is the host of the Cirque De Soleil Zumanity show in Las Vegas. As she quickly points out, the show is a wild and nude ride into the animal and human relationship. There is a point where she is talking about the orgy scene in the show with Greg and it’s beyond great. It’s the part of Nene that is always enjoyable to watch. The past few seasons its seemed like Nene has lost that fun edge that made viewers fall in love with her. There are a few things that could have contributed to this change to hardcore Nene. She’s been given the star treatment by having guest spots on Glee and a role on The New Normal but since Normal was cancelled, it hit her hard. Granted, she also did time on The Celebrity Apprentice and Dancing with the Stars but those were short lived. Nene has always been the “leader” of the Atlanta housewives which makes her a powerhouse on Bravo, much like Lisa Vanderpump and Bethenny Frankel. Once she’s stepped even farther into the spotlight though, there have been more hurdles. Maybe this season there will be a return to her humor roots. That’s the Nene that can rule the world.

Phaedra is staying away in a hotel on the morning of Apollo’s court hearing to avoid the paparazzi for her kids. As the world now knows, Apollo has been brought up on fraud charges. This was truly a sad and difficult portion to watch. First off, Phaedra is pulling the “its all his fault” card when it comes to the fraud. It may never be known for sure if she had knowledge of what he was doing, but the fact that she isn’t supporting him by just being there for the court hearing is brutal. She’s ready to cut him loose and raise their two boys on her own. She claims it’s because she feels betrayed and needs to teach Apollo that life has consequences. Apollo makes a heap of sense though when expressing his heartbreak over feeling alone. Did he do something highly illegal and worthy of prison time? Absolutely. The man should have his family by his side in some form though. It will be interesting to see the transformation of their marriage over this season.
The rest of the ladies did not receive much spotlight this episode. Kenya just got home after traveling the world for three months. Of course she’s still reeling from the Porsha attack at the last reunion. Porter turned herself in to the police for assaulting Kenya, but the bad blood between them still has not fizzled. Kenya is a difficult presence still because she causes so much trouble to come her way. It was of course wrong for Porsha to attack Kenya physically, but Kenya had it coming. No more props at reunions Andy.
Cynthia is still rocking her Bailey Agency. Of course when it comes to Bar One, Peter has to find another location since the original was foreclosed. They have talks of partnering and it just brings in the message that once again, Cynthia’s story will revolve around finances. While this is a topic that is dealt with in all marriages, Peter and Cynthia win the gold medal on consistency. At least it gives them something to talk about? Kandi and Todd are living life after marriage. Todd’s daughter is coming to live in Atlanta finally so they’re melding their household into a family of four. Viewers were hoping to see more about where Mama Joyce stands on Todd, but it’ll definitely pop up as the season continues.
